			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>THE #1 KILLER OF TEENS ARE TEEN DRIVERS!</h2>
<p>JourneySafe is an outreach program established by Dr. David &amp; Donna Sabet, parents of Jill Sabet.  Jill and her boyfriend, Jonathan <a href="http://www.cmaalliance.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/homepage_Jill_Jon_pullout.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-835" title="homepage_Jill_Jon_pullout" src="http://www.cmaalliance.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/homepage_Jill_Jon_pullout.jpg" alt="" width="120" height="109" /></a>Schulte (photo) were two remarkable teens who lost their lives May 26, 2005 in a senseless single vehicle automobile crash. They were passengers in a friend&#8217;s overcrowded car on the way to their junior prom. It was no freak accident and no drugs or alcohol were involved: just an instant of distraction in which the young driver looked away from the road searching for a pack of gum, then panicked and lost control of the car.</p>
<p>After Jill&#8217;s tragic death, the Sabet&#8217;s recognized the major contribution that distraction causes in the deaths of over 6,000 teens annually.  They created the JourneySafe program, an educational outreach of the “Gillian Sabet Memorial Foundation” that utilizes the “Remember the 5 Tips” to survive.  The primary goal of the JourneySafe program is to educate teens and parents about the unique risks faced by young drivers and their passengers. Using the story of Jill and Jonathan and focusing on the teens that are killed each year in similar automobile crashes, JourneySafe promotes and teaches a &#8220;positive peer pressure &#8212; friends protecting friends&#8221; concept that teens can use as a tool to protect themselves and each other on and off the road.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>On October 6, 2010, the Fresno-Madera Medical Society Alliance, in conjunction with their medical society, held the CMAA sponsored Regional Conference, “Making Order Out of Medical Practice Chaos”. There were forty-seven attendees; many were CMAA members.  Attendance was also open to Office Managers who worked in offices where the physician was a CMA member.</p>
<p>Frank Navarro, CMA Associate Director of Economics Services, spoke to the issues of payor abuse and encouraged members to contact his department directly for assistance with particularly difficult reimbursement issues; Marsh Lose, Risk Management specialist with NORCAL, addressed “Hot Topics in Risk Management.  Paul Hegyi, CMA Government Relations shared the status of health care reform legislation at the state level.   On a different theme, Aamer Hayat, of Avecinia Wellness Center demonstrated how the center used social media, primarily Facebook, to stay in touch with their patients.  The last speaker, Ken Ellzey, MD, of Kaiser Permanente Wellness Department, discussed the “Six Pathways to Wellness”.  The evaluations indicated that each of the speakers was well received and every attendee left feeling that she/he had gained some extremely valuable information, both in their role as office manager as well as personally.</p>
